About The Role
As a Registered Nurse at a Barchester care home, you'll look after the physical, psychological, and social needs of our residents to help us deliver the quality care they deserve.
You'll be responsible for creating a safe and supportive environment for residents with a range of physical and mental needs, making critical clinical decisions using your professional judgment. Your duties include developing tailored care plans, administering medication safely, and ensuring excellence in all aspects of your role. As a Registered Nurse (RGN), you'll have the autonomy to do things the right way and be truly valued and respected for your contributions.
About You
You need to have current NMC registration and a strong knowledge of up-to-date clinical practices. Experience in producing detailed care plans and risk assessments, along with understanding regulatory frameworks such as DoLs/MCA and Royal Pharmaceutical guidelines, is essential. Dedication and compassion are vital, and you'll pride yourself on a person-centered, thoughtful approach to nursing.
